About This Grant

Numerous studies have shed light on the capability of T cells in facilitating HIV entry into the central nervous system (CNS) and HIV-associated brain injury (HABI) in the era of combined antiretroviral therapy (cART); yet, one critical question remains - what differentiates and/or predicts T cell behavior in individuals with HABI from those without? Preliminary machine learning has identified unique signatures of viral adaptation in infected peripheral blood T cells from S[imian]IV-infected Rhesus macaques with mild-to-moderate neuroinflammation, begging the question as to whether select viral variants are capable of re-programming T cell migration. On the other hand, T cell migration is dictated by cell differentiation state (e.g., naive vs memory phenotype), and recent evidence indicates this differentiated state can be influenced by T cell receptor (TCR) sequence features. Somatic rearrangement of the genes forming the TCR sequence within an individual results in natural TCR heterogeneity that may not only explain differences in T cell neuroinvasive capabilities across HIV-infected individuals, but may be used to identify individuals who would benefit from therapies used in other T cell-mediated neurological disorders, such as multiple sclerosis. We propose to address the underlying questions of viral and TCR influences on differential T cell migration and neuroinvasion using a multitude of single-cell techniques applied to human tissue and an extensive collection of CNS and peripheral tissues from the macaque model of HIV infection in the presence and absence of T cell trafficking inhibitor - natalizumab. Combining strengths in viral, immunological, and computational research, we propose to tackle these long-standing questions specifically by 1) identifying unique viral and/or T cell properties associated with T cell infiltration in the CNS (Aim 1), 2) characterizing the relationship between viral infection, TCR features, and T cell migration potential (Aim 2), and 3) evaluating the impact of natalizumab on T cell trafficking, viral dynamics, and neuroinflammation (Aim 3). Importantly, recent findings of the role of the complex interplay of viral and T cell genetics in the neurological disorder - multiple sclerosis - point to a phenomenon that may span multiple diseases, indicating the in-depth characterization of this interplay has potentially broader implications than HIV infection.
